St. Catharines Museum & Welland Canals Centre:

A Municipal Museum with permanent and temporary exhibits that illustrate the history of St. Catharines and its people: The Welland Canals, the Underground Railroad, and the Ontario Lacrosse Hall of Fame & Museum. At the Centre you can also experience the technological marvel that is the Welland Canal Locks - head outside to experience the Lock 3 Ship Viewing Platform.

St. Catharines Culture:

The Cultural Services office is a division of the City of St. Catharines’ Community, Recreation and Culture Services department. Cultural Services focuses on public art, community development, planning and policy related to arts and culture in the City of St. Catharines.
